The postcode PO16 8NW is located in Fareham, in the county of Hampsh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. PO16 8NW is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

PO16 8NW is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 6.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of PO16 8NW as Suburbanites > Semi-detached suburbia > White suburban communities.

The closest road name to PO16 8NW is The Kingsway which is centered 43 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Westlands Grove and is 131 m away. The closest railway station is Portchester Rail Station, 634 m away.

The closest primary school to PO16 8NW (for ages 11 and under) is Red Barn Community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Outstanding on March 23, 2012.

The local pub for residents of PO16 8NW is The Seagull and is 420 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on September 29,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Ruby Chinese Take Away and is 185 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on March 31,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 124.7 Mbps and an average upload speed of 16.7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.7 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for PO16 8NW is covered by the Hampshire police force association and Hampsh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
